## Component Library Versioning — Data Stores

The Lanternkit shared component library records every published version in the `libver` store, which support can query when triaging mismatched-UI tickets. Each row maps a release tag to the consuming apps pinned to it. Note that pre-release tags are retained for 90 days only. Before running any lookup, confirm you are pointed at the read replica. Connect using the following string.

primary connection of yagep-kahip = redis://giliel_svc:zYiKsLL2PLpfPL@db-348f.xolmarsys.corp:5432/fenwyn

Log sampling for Murmurline: this service emits roughly 40k lines per minute, so we sample aggressively. The sampler keeps all ERROR lines, 10% of WARN, and 1% of INFO, configured in sampling.yaml. If you change the rates, regenerate the config bundle with the pack-config script and note the change in the maintainers' log — downstream dashboards assume these ratios. The packed bundle is verified at startup, so it must be signed before rollout. Sign it with the following deploy key.

deploy key for kajof-fajop: bky6_gDHw9Q

## Deploying the Gatewick Proctor Queue

Deploys are pretty painless: push to main, wait for the pipeline, then watch the queue drain dashboard for five minutes. If candidates pile up mid-exam, roll back first and ask questions later — the queue replays safely. Everything the workers care about lives in one config block, shown here for reference.

settings of bafof-yagef:
JOROX_PIN=8740
JOROX_TENANT=pelox
JOROX_METRICS_HOST=metrics.jorox.qorvelworks.internal
JOROX_SEAL=seal_c78f63c1
JOROX_STANDBY_TEAM=norax

v2.8.1 — Fixed rounding errors in the Lundqvist currency converter; conversions now use banker's rounding with minor-unit precision per currency. Regression tests added for three-decimal currencies. As part of this release, the artifact signing key was rotated per policy. All builds from v2.8.1 onward are signed with the new key below.

rollout seal: bky9_PeXH1fTLY